Hotels, good and bad
Prompt: Tell us about a memorable hotel experience. What made it that way... the hotel or the location or both?
Well of course at my time of life my hotel visits have been many and varied and I have many stories to tell. Most would be from our travels. Although we were both in our sixties when we set out to backpack through India, Thailand and The Philippines we were definitely on a budget.

My basic criteria were that the room must have aircon and a bathroom. Now often the term 'bathroom ' was used loosely. Usually it would be a squat toilet and a trickle of cold water in the shower. But often the shabby rooms would have amazing views. The rickety bungalows were situated on white sandy beaches with uninterrupted views of the Ocean. The bungalows I'm thinking of were in Phuket and were totally obliterated in the Tsunami a year after we stayed there. Thousand of people were killed, washed out to sea.

My favourite hotel room was a room on a cruise ship. Butler service and the sound of the waves through the open window on the balcony, lulling me to sleep. Unbeatable.
